Average Library Assistants, Clerical Salary in U.S.
In U.S., the average annual salary for Library Assistants, Clerical is $36,970. This figure precisely matches the national average, indicating a stable compensation landscape for this role. Factors such as local demand for library services and the general economic conditions within U.S. likely contribute to this alignment.
Executive Summary
- Average Salary: $36,970 per year.
-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 22.3% ↗ over the last 5 years.
-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$51,840.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 12,420 employees in the U.S. area with a job density of per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
